I've been checking my levels at various times of the day and how things affect it...this is what I've found so far.......

Fancy Fish and Chips from the chippy - go for it, but ask for a small chips and leave half of them!
Behave the next day to balance it out.

Dry spirits and Slimline mixers? - what better excuse do you need to get happy on G & Ts :D

Had the drinks and want a Kebab? Ask for chicken or lamb skewers - they're done on a hot plate. Tell them you dont want the Pitta or Naan, just to put it in a tray with salad topping and have a squirt of chilli and garlic sauce. Doesn't put the sugar level up by hardly anything!

Most of the changes that i've made to my diet havent really bothered me that much but I love the idea of Cauli and butter mashed... but will my mates still speak to me after the event??? LOL.

Wholemeal bread is a definite 'YUK' but Granary rolls - love em. (even without butter - great with soup).
